Understanding the Albumin/Globulin (A/G) Ratio Test: What It Reveals About Your Health
Protein is an essential component that plays a role in many functional activities of the body. Total protein in the blood consists of three main components: albumin, globulin, and a small amount of fibrinogen. Both albumin and alpha globulin as well as beta globulin are primarily synthesized in the liver, which is why the Albumin/Globulin ratio in blood tests is used to assess liver function. Certain diseases can affect the concentration of Albumin or Globulin in the blood; therefore, the ratio of these two indicators reflects the condition and function of the liver.
